> I have another question. Suppose I have two domains: foo.com and bar.com.
> Both point to an MX server: mx1.sample.com. However, on mx1.sample.com, I
> want to route bar.com's emails to mx2.sample.com, because mx2.sample.com has
> the complete user database for bar.com, and mx2.sample.com is only
> accessible from restricted IP addresses. In mx1.sample.com's postfix
> configuration, I'm using the following settings:
> 
> relay_domains = bar.com
>     transport_maps = inline:{
>     { bar.com = relay:[mx2.sample.com] }}
> 
> Is this configuration correct? Thank you.

Correct, but not complete, it is missing a recipient table for the relay
domain, you need:

    # Real table if more than a handful of users.
    relay_recipient_maps = inline:{
        { la...@bar.com = exists },
        { moe@bar@.com = exists },
        { cu...@bar.com = exists },
        }
